本文目录导读:
在分布式存储系统中,副本策略是保证数据可靠性和系统可用性的关键,副本策略的不同,将直接影响到系统的性能、成本和可靠性,本文将重点分析分布式存储系统中3副本与1-6副本策略的区别,探讨各自的优势和适用场景。
副本策略概述
分布式存储系统中的副本策略是指将数据在不同节点上复制多个副本,以实现数据的冗余备份,常见的副本策略包括:
1、1副本:数据在分布式存储系统中只存储一个副本,适用于对成本敏感的场景。
图片来源于网络,如有侵权联系删除
2、3副本:数据在分布式存储系统中存储3个副本,具有较好的可靠性和性能。
3、4副本:数据在分布式存储系统中存储4个副本,比3副本具有更高的可靠性,但会增加存储成本。
4、5副本:数据在分布式存储系统中存储5个副本,比4副本具有更高的可靠性,但成本更高。
5、6副本:数据在分布式存储系统中存储6个副本,具有最高的可靠性,但成本最高。
3副本与1-6副本策略的区别
1、可靠性
3副本策略:在3副本策略中,当任意两个副本发生故障时,系统仍能保证数据的完整性,但在极端情况下,当所有副本同时发生故障时,数据将丢失。
1-6副本策略:1-6副本策略具有更高的可靠性,当任意副本发生故障时,系统仍能保证数据的完整性,但在极端情况下,当所有副本同时发生故障时,数据将丢失。
图片来源于网络,如有侵权联系删除
2、性能
3副本策略:3副本策略在性能方面表现较好,因为数据副本数量较少,读写操作较为简单。
1-6副本策略:1-6副本策略在性能方面相对较差,因为数据副本数量较多,读写操作复杂,容易产生冲突。
3、成本
3副本策略:3副本策略在成本方面相对较低,因为副本数量较少,存储空间需求较小。
1-6副本策略:1-6副本策略在成本方面较高,因为副本数量较多,存储空间需求较大。
4、适用场景
图片来源于网络,如有侵权联系删除
3副本策略:适用于对性能和成本敏感的场景,如个人云存储、小型企业数据存储等。
1-6副本策略:适用于对数据可靠性要求较高的场景,如金融、医疗、政府等领域的数据存储。
分布式存储系统中的副本策略对数据可靠性和系统性能具有重要影响,3副本与1-6副本策略在可靠性、性能、成本和适用场景等方面存在明显差异,在实际应用中,应根据具体需求和场景选择合适的副本策略,以实现最优的性能和成本平衡。
分布式存储系统中的副本策略是一个复杂且重要的课题,通过对3副本与1-6副本策略的比较分析,我们可以更好地了解各自的优势和适用场景,为实际应用提供有益的参考,在实际部署过程中,还需结合具体需求和场景,对副本策略进行优化和调整,以实现最佳的性能和成本平衡。
标签: #分布式存储3副本与1-6副本区别
评论列表